#f7ab46 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f7ab46 is composed of 96.9% red, 67.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 34.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 62.2%. #f7ab46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#ef5700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

● #f7ab46 color description : Bright orange.
The hexadecimal color #f7ab46 has RGB values of R:247, G:171,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.72,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16231238.
